WHAT RIGHTS DOES THE DATA SUBJECT HAVE IN RELATION TO PERSONAL DATA PROTECTION?

The data subject has the following rights, in particular:

  • the right to withdraw consent at any time,

  • the right to rectify or supplement personal data,

  • the right to request the restriction of processing,

  • the right to object or lodge a complaint,

  • the right to data portability,

  • the right to access personal data,

  • the right to be informed of a personal data breach in certain cases,

  • the right to erasure of personal data (the “right to be forgotten”).

IS IT POSSIBLE TO OBTAIN A COPY OF THE PROCESSED PERSONAL DATA?

DAKO-CZ will provide a copy of processed personal data upon request of the data subject whose personal data have been processed. For additional copies, DAKO-CZ may charge a reasonable fee to cover administrative costs. If the data subject submits a request electronically, the information will also be provided in a commonly used electronic form, unless the data subject requests otherwise. The information is provided without undue delay and in any case within one calendar month of receiving the request.
